I'm also a newbie, but this is my working configuration (NowSMS acts as SMSC).
# the bearerbox connects to the SMSCs group = smsc smsc = smpp smsc-id = klaussmsc host = 8.12.12.12 # transceiver only supported bym SMPP >=3.4 # transceiver-mode = 1 # # these ports are configured at the NowSMS software port = 12000 receive-port = 12000 smsc-username = "asdf" # smsc password max. 8 letters smsc-password = afsgsdg system-type = "VMA" #The interface version will be reported to the SMSC #interface-version = "33" interface-version = "34" # numbers which are allowed to send SMS messages to us (to kannel via smsc) address-range = "" idle-timeout = 300
